The Role:

If you offer first class administrative, interpersonal and communication skills, this position offers an exciting opportunity to play a key role in the admissions process for Croydon High Junior School.

This role is crucial in ensuring all prospective pupils and their families receive a positive impression of the school throughout the admissions process.

You will ensure that all enquiries are followed up within agreed timescales and will process all applications in accordance with required procedures, including making arrangements for interviews and school visits, and coordinating arrangements for entrance assessments.

You will also provide support with the planning of marketing events for the Junior School, such as open days as well as act as liaison with feeder and local schools, nurseries and external partners.

Maintaining pupil records and databases and ensuring that information is up-to-date, readily accessible, and managed in accordance with data protection requirements, is also a key responsibility for this role.

About You

You will need the ability to relate well to people on all levels with sensitivity, tact and diplomacy and will be able to remain calm under pressure and work to tight deadlines; with a systematic approach to tasks, and strong attention to detail.

Experience of managing databases is also essential.

You will also need training and/or experience in essential Microsoft Office applications, as well as knowledge of office management processes.

A good telephone manner and the ability to deal with callers and visitors in a calm and courteous way are equally important.


Why Croydon High School?

Established in 1874, Croydon High School prides itself on its innovative approach and friendly atmosphere. The School is located in Selsdon, south of Croydon, on a beautiful campus. Croydon High is made up of students from a broad and culturally diverse range of backgrounds and the school recognises and hugely values the positive impact this has on all who teach and learn here.
